Job description

Our Charlotte technology team is hiring a Cyber Security Analyst to support daily Security Operations Center (SOC) monitoring, threat detection, and incident response. In this role, you will analyze security alerts escalated from Tier 1, investigate potential endpoint and network compromises, and manage vulnerability remediation across our enterprise infrastructure.

You will work closely with our infrastructure and network engineering teams to tune SIEM correlation rules, perform root-cause analysis on security incidents, and ensure compliance with framework standards., * Monitor enterprise SIEM dashboards (Splunk / Microsoft Sentinel) to analyze, triage, and investigate escalated security events and potential alerts.

  • Conduct initial incident response for phishing attempts, unauthorized access, malware infections, and credential abuse across endpoints and cloud environments (Azure / M365).
  • Run weekly vulnerability scans using Qualys or Tenable, prioritize critical CVE exposure, and collaborate with system administrators to verify patch deployment.
  • Review firewalls, EDR agents (CrowdStrike / Defender for Endpoint), and email security gateway logs to identify anomalous network traffic or suspicious process executions.
  • Write incident post-mortem reports, document indicators of compromise (IOCs), and update internal Security Orchestration, Automation, and Response (SOAR) playbooks.
  • Assist in internal access certification reviews, privileged access management (PAM) audits, and third-party vendor security risk assessments.

Requirements

  • 2 to 4 years of hands-on experience in a SOC, threat monitoring, or cybersecurity analyst role.
  • Direct working experience with enterprise SIEM platforms (Splunk, Sentinel, or QRadar) and EDR tools (CrowdStrike, Defender, or SentinelOne).
  • Solid understanding of network protocols (TCP/IP, DNS, HTTP/S, BGP) and enterprise authentication models (Active Directory, Entra ID, Okta).
  • Active industry certification required (CompTIA Security+, CySA+, GIAC GSEC, or Network+).
  • B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ity, Information Technology, Computer Science, or equivalent practical work experience.
  • Must hold valid US work authorization without requiring current or future employer sponsorship.
